san francisco giants live score
san francisco giants live score, san francisco giants score today, san francisco and giants score, sf giants game today live time score, sf giants current score, sf giants score for today, current score of the sf giants game, score for sf giants game today, sf giants score now, sf giants official site scores
san francisco giants live score. There are any references about san francisco giants live score in here. you can look below.
san francisco giants live score
san francisco giants score today
san francisco and giants score
sf giants game today live time score
sf giants current score
sf giants score for today
current score of the sf giants game
score for sf giants game today
sf giants score now
sf giants official site scores
san francisco giants live score, san francisco giants score today, san francisco and giants score, sf giants game today live time score, sf giants current score, sf giants score for today, current score of the sf giants game, score for sf giants game today, sf giants score now, sf giants official site scores